What is in the PD Toolkit?
Receive a printed Overview Field Guide which explains more about Participatory Design, the approaches, framework and methodologies which P!D adopts for its projects as well as Case Studies. An exclusive Postcard, Sticker Pack and Notebook designed by P!D is also included in this Toolkit. The Toolkit is designed to better engage and involve the community in design projects. It is packed with activities, tips and techniques to foster dialogue and create informed design goals.
Where does your money go?
As a design non-profit organisation, the surplus from P!D SCHOOL will contribute to our social good projects and advocacy work which includes publication, talks and community projects that aims to empower communities through participatory design and inspire the next generation of creatives.
Participate in Design is a registered non-profit organisation and a public company by limited guarantee in Singapore.
